How they compare
Cambodia currently reports 100.0% against 89.5% in South Asia, a difference of 10.5%.
That makes Cambodia's figure about 1.1 times South Asia's.
Across all 10 years both countries report, Cambodia has been ahead every year.
Cambodia ranks 1st and South Asia ranks 4th of 83 countries.
Cambodia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Trained teachers in lower secondary education are the percentage of lower secondary school teachers who have received the minimum organized teacher training (pre-service or in-service) required for teaching in a given country.
